Request 26b Update the table to include solvent losses and bitumen production on a<br />

volumetric basis.<br />

Response 26b Table ERCB 26-3 and ERCB 26-4 provide volumetric data for site-wide solvent<br />

loss for each material balance case with and without the asphaltene recovery unit.<br />
